Space Science

New Universes Will be Born from Ours 440

David Shiga writes "What gruesome fate awaits our universe? Some physicists have argued that it is doomed to be ripped apart by runaway dark energy, while others think it is bouncing through an endless series of big bangs and big crunches. Now, scientists have combined these two ideas to create another option, in which our universe ultimately shatters into billions of pieces. Each shard would then subsequently grow into a whole new universe. The model could solve the mystery of why our early universe was surprisingly well ordered."

    • Re:Evidence (Score:5, Informative)

      by Ambitwistor ( 1041236 ) on Friday February 09, 2007 @01:54PM (#17950868)
      Right now, the theory with the most evidence in its favor is the theory which includes a dark energy described by Einstein's cosmological constant. In that theory, the universe's expansion will continue to accelerate forever, although not at such a great rate that there is a "Big Rip" which tears atoms apart. That is the "heat death" scenario, in which the universe lasts forever and runs down until nothing much is going on. Because of the accelerating expansion, we will see fewer and fewer distant galaxies as time goes on, because they will accelerate away from us faster than light can reach us. Ultimately we will only see a few local galaxies in the cluster in which we are bound.

      This scenario is explored in more detail here [ucr.edu].

      However, it's possible that the dark energy is dynamical instead of constant, and so the expansion of the universe could accelerate or possibly even reverse and decelerate. With enough deceleration, a Big Crunch is still feasible. There are also the scenarios in which our universe spawns new "universes", such as the one discussed here.

        • Re: (Score:3, Informative)

          I don't wholly agree with your analysis. An atom is an electromagnetically bound system and resists expansion; you can't just take a straight Friedmann GR solution and make conclusions from that. That's why the Big Rip scenario was invented: it is an acceleration so severe that even bound systems become unbound by the cosmological expansion. A cosmological constant (w=-1) is right on the boundary: atoms become unbound only asymptotically. There is no actual finite time at which atoms (or galaxies) fa
